According to the release, the main source of conflict in 2022 is bears trying to enter the waste. “Other common sources of conflict include bird feeders, livestock, bears entering open garages, and other man-made things that are left unprotected.”

Governor Jared Polis signed HB 21-1326 in 2022 to reduce human-bear conflicts. “This bill provides funding for the Colorado Department of Natural Resources and CPW, including $1 million to local communities to conserve native species,” the release said.

After averaging a program record of 10,392 in 2012-13 (a record 7 sales), attendance declined slightly in each of the next six seasons. In 2013-14 and 2014-15, CU averaged over 9,600, but in 2015-16 it dropped to 8,540.

Attendance continued to decline over the next three seasons – 7,772 in 2016-17, 7,449 in 2017-18 and 7,185 in 2018-19 – before a slight recovery in 2019-20 (7,979) could be reached. the beginning of an epidemic.
